What Are Reviews of Modded Apps?
Modded apps are altered versions of official programs developed by outside third-party programmers. These versions change the code of the original software to get beyond limitations or activate extra features. A modded Spotify might, for example, offer ad-free music streaming or unlimited skips—typically reserved for premium members. Likewise, with characteristics like offline downloads, modified Netflix APKs might provide access to all series and movies, including premium content.

Pros and Cons of Using Modded Apps
Advantages:
Cost Efficiency: Gain access to premium features for free.
Full Feature Unlock: Experience the best of apps without barriers.
Convenience: Skip ads or restrictions, making apps more user-friendly.
Disadvantages:
Legal Implications:
Modded apps violate app developers’ copyright terms and may be illegal in many territories.
Users risk penalties, including fines or account suspensions.
Security Risks:
Modded apps come from unofficial sources, leaving users vulnerable to viruses, malware, and data breaches.
Hackers design some APK files to steal data, including login credentials or personal information.
Unpredictable Functionality:
Expect crashes or bugs due to modified code.
Updates may break the mod’s functionality or create incompatibilities.
Ethical Considerations:
Using modded apps takes revenue away from developers who rely on subscription fees for maintenance and development.
A Real-World Example
Consider someone who downloads a modded Spotify APK for free access to premium features. Initially, it works well. But after a mandatory app update, the APK breaks, leaving their account flagged for unusual activity. Suddenly, they cannot use Spotify at all, making the initial “free access” more of a hassle.
This reflects the larger problem with modded apps. While the premium experience comes free, the cost may be paid in security breaches, legal trouble, or permanent bans.
